> GNU Guix is now capable of producing up-to-date source tarballs for
> IceCat that should hopefully build on any system that IceCat supports.
> 
> For example, GNU Guix has icecat-60.7.2-guix1, which includes fixes for
> CVE-2019-11707 and CVE-2019-11708, which are apparently quite serious
> flaws that are being actively exploited in the wild.
> 
> The IceCat source tarballs produced by GNU Guix are almost identical to
> the official IceCat tarballs, except that the timestamps and file
> ordering in the tarball are canonicalized, and a few manifest files
> within the tarball are sorted differently.
> 
> After installing Guix <https://gnu.org/s/guix>, the command to produce
> the IceCat tarball is:
> 
>   guix build --source icecat
